Output 79f32b424ee8cbe3025fa5f5da64f75938f62b001010f5b51ef912fbb7d644db:3

value
6974986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afaa3ba4c82bb7cbe75ce5617861c7b04e25af69 OP_EQUAL
address
3Hhr77HH1vWZmhYbKQdkEXFk73kUUDiJWH
transaction
79f32b424ee8cbe3025fa5f5da64f75938f62b001010f5b51ef912fbb7d644db
confirmations
467101
spent
true